Acquanetta, nicknamed "The Venezuelan Volcano," was an American B-movie actress during the 1940s and 1950s. Acquanetta was most known for her exotic beauty.
Birth Name
Mildred Davenport
Born
Sunday, 17 July 1921
Died
Monday, 16 August 2004
